Bobby, Griff, Rick, and Zack complete their Mortal Kombat Trilogy by reviewing the brand new MK film. Then we tackle a little bit of retro gaming by talking about our favorite old disney video games... damn Lion King is still hard! Lastly we dive head first into the oscars by playing a brand new ouund of The Eff You Say!? Where Griff takes the synopsis' of Oscar snubbed films, and runs them through mutiple languages on google translate until we can't decipher them anymore. It's quite a doozie. Listen and find out what it's like to win a flawless victory... and get yourself EFFIN CULTURED!
